23 | * Mississippi ducked under a moving horse to take a shot at a guy. When asked why, he defends himself on how "a horse will not step on a man." He's honestly surprised when the others make it clear that ''yes'', it would. |
24 | * The scene where Cole gauges Mississippi as a gunfighter. Cole shoots the arm of a cactus and then gives his gun to Mississippi. Mississippi decides to use a quick-draw-like move and shoots a nearby bush. Mississippi looks pleased with himself until Cole asks if he ''meant'' to hit that bush, to which Mississippi confesses that he was trying to hit the same cactus. |
25 | ** Cole decides to solve the issue by getting Mississippi a sawed-off shotgun. While useful for someone who can't aim well, [[spoiler:this manages to bite Cole in the end. While the whole gang is being patched up, the surgeon notes that the leg wound Cole received was caused by a single shot from a shotgun.]] Mississippi was the only one using a shotgun at the time and confesses to the deed in embarrassment. Bull ribs him a bit, explaining that the safest place to be when Mississippi fires is ''behind'' Mississippi. |
